Pork belly has become a trendy item on restaurant menus, rediscovered by chefs for its incredible flavor and versatility. Its 48% fat content isn't a curse, but a blessing, making it rich and delicious.
Breeders have increasingly bred pigs to be leaner due to market demand, resulting in less flavorful cuts like the now-dry pork loin and pork chops, avoiding the delicious marbling found in fattier options.
